BENEFITS
There are many benefits associated with going on
a family vacation. After all, without having to
contend with work, school, or your usual social
calendar, you can spend more quality time with
each other than ever before. While you may view
an escape from your home and routine as something
to look forward to, this can be an incredibly
daunting experience for children with autism and
related disorders. This is because they tend to
thrive in familiar environments and prefer to
stick to a consistent routine as a result.

PUT TOGETHER A VACATION SCHEDULE
While you may be keen to catch up on sleep and
enjoy a more relaxed pace of life during your
vacation, putting together some schedule or
routine can help your child manage feelings of
stress and anxiety. This is because they feel
like they are not stepping into the
unknown. For example, you could list everything
you want to do during your vacation and discuss
these options with your child. If youre going to
be visiting specific attractions, show them
pictures ahead of time so they have an idea of
what to expect when they arrive.

BRING SOME HOME COMFORTS WITH YOU
Bringing some home comforts with you can also
help your child to feel more relaxed on vacation.
For example, if they have sensory issues, they
may not like the feeling of certain fabrics or
materials, which could mean they wont be able to
sleep using hotel bed sheets. Bringing your own
from home provides them with a sense of comfort
while also ensuring they get enough sleep.

While taking steps to prepare your child for your
vacation ensures they have the best possible
time, you should also be aware of the signs that
indicate they are struggling or feel overwhelmed.
This puts you in the best possible situation to
do something about it quickly. For example, you
may notice they are stimming much more intensely
or often. This can be combated by identifying the
trigger and working to reduce its impact on their
day. For example, if youre in an overly noisy
environment, you could move to a quieter space or
reach for sound-canceling headphones.

CHAT WITH THEIR THERAPIST
If your child is enrolled in some kind of
interventive therapy, such as Applied Behavior
Analysis, speaking with their therapist
beforehand is also useful. This is because
theyll have a deeper understanding of your
childs needs and what you need to do to support
them when traveling. With decades of experience
